C&P Galley – The Lobster Place
There are several eatery places inside the Chelsea Market, and they do have good selections, fresh, and tasty. C&P Galley is a quick service seafood joint, run by Cull & Pistol restaurant (right by it, offering sushi, oysters, etc.). Le Chéile
Le Chéile is an eclectic restaurant with an Irish theme, and serves many kinds of beers and pub grub & American dishes. They say that their name“Le Chéile” (pronounced – “leh kay-lah”) is a Gaelic phrase which means “together.” It has a nice bright color throughout, both inside and outside.
